Ambassador of Sri Lanka to Thailand, Wijayanthi Edirisinghe, met with the Director General of the Department of Business Development (DBD) under the Ministry of Commerce of Thailand, Auramon Supthaweethum, on 08th April 2025 to explore opportunities for deepening bilateral trade and business cooperation.
The Department of Business Development is a key government agency responsible for regulating, supporting, and promoting business operations in Thailand. Its core functions include the registration of business entities such as sole proprietorships, partnerships, limited companies, and foreign business operations. The DBD also maintains Thailand’s official Business Registration Database and provides essential training, advisory services, and market access tools to support SMEs and startups.
During the meeting, Ambassador Edirisinghe appreciated the long-standing and cordial bilateral relationship between Sri Lanka and Thailand, which is underpinned by shared cultural, religious, and trade ties. She acknowledged Thailand’s pivotal role in promoting regional economic integration and expressed Sri Lanka’s keen interest in deepening economic engagement between the two countries.
In response, Director General Auramon Supthaweethum welcomed the initiative and extended Thailand’s support to Sri Lankan businesses seeking to establish operations in Thailand. She assured that the DBD would facilitate the business registration process for Sri Lankan companies and offered to organize training programmes for Sri Lankan SMEs, focusing on market access, business development, and promotional strategies.
This meeting marks another step forward in enhancing economic collaboration between Sri Lanka and Thailand and reflects the shared commitment to harnessing regional trade opportunities for mutual benefit.
